2012-04-12 46 views
6

Khi tôi tạo một nút có macro được đính kèm, và di con trỏ chuột qua nút, nó sẽ nhấp nháy giữa con trỏ trỏ mặc định và trông giống như bàn tay chỉ trắng còn 1 pixel nữa.Dừng con trỏ chuột Excel từ nhấp nháy trên nút

Bất kỳ ý tưởng nào về cách sửa lỗi này?

+0

bạn đã bao giờ tìm thấy giải pháp cho vấn đề này chưa? Tôi đang gặp vấn đề tương tự và nó thực sự gây phiền nhiễu – MZimmerman6

+0

@ MZimmerman6, tôi e rằng tôi chưa bao giờ tìm được giải pháp. – Joe

+0

darn, cảm ơn bạn đã phản hồi – MZimmerman6

Trả lời

0

Đặt mã sau đây trước mã khiến con trỏ nhấp nháy đồng hồ cát.

Application.Cursor = xlNorthwestArrow 'Stops mouse pointer flashing hourglass 

Điều đó sẽ ngừng nhấp nháy.

+4

Con trỏ chuột nhấp nháy khi tôi chỉ cần di chuột qua nút, trước khi bất kỳ mã macro nào thực sự đang chạy. – Joe

1

Tôi đã gặp sự cố tương tự (nếu không phải vấn đề tương tự).

  1. Khi không di chuyển chuột, nhưng di chuột qua nút, bàn tay có vẻ nhấp nháy.
  2. Khi di chuyển chuột và chuyển qua một nút, bàn tay nhấp nháy và con trỏ sẽ chậm lại.

Tham chiếu giải pháp Scoox ', tôi đã đặt mã vào chức năng để kích hoạt khi sổ làm việc mở.

Private Sub Workbook_Open() 
    Application.Cursor = xlNorthwestArrow 
End Sub 

Điều này đã loại bỏ nhấp nháy chuột tĩnh và độ trễ trong chuyển động của con trỏ qua nút. Tuy nhiên, nếu bạn di chuyển chậm qua nút, vẫn có một số nhấp nháy nhẹ.

Các vấn đề liên quan